A tip that the experienced individuals agree on is looking after the filters. The filters in many Tempe heating systems can usually obtain a lot of dirt and debris. As an outcome, they can make the entire thing less efficient and also cause other parts to get worn out faster. To remedy this bit of difficulty, temporarily turn off the warmth in your residence and slide the filter out from its place next to the motorized mechanics. On it, you will see the important information on what type it is and instructions on how to clean it. You can also ask a regional technician for a step by step process.
Experts suggest that you should check for signs of corrosion. One of the biggest threats to various Arizona heating systems during its functioning life is corrosion. If left unchecked, it can really damage the system and interfere with its output. Certain inhibitors are usually used to minimize the damaging effects on the entire circulation of you and your family’s housing. These chemicals are put in the water so they can be be fully exposed and dosed with a dosage of heat. Which from there, they can go on and form a small yet effective layer inside the pipes, thus preventing any type of corrosion or eat away at the plumbing in your house is no longer a concern..
Finally, it is best to check and make sure that the pilot is good and free of any related problems. The reason why is because that small problem could be the whole cause of this entire mess. If the flame is off when it is should to be on, it could mean you have sealed off valve or a largely clogged pilot. Start off by cleaning all the blockages from the opening then carefully attempt to ignite the flame. Various Arizona heater repair professionals recommend you be supervised while doing this. If the fire still does not ignite, it could be that the flame has been set too low. You should change and rotate the valve and try taking doing it again. Ensure that the thermocouple is working properly and well, and then you can tighten the thermocouple nut to make the it stays lit and it wasn’t a temporary moment of success.
